#07264d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#07264d is composed of 2.7% red, 14.9% green and 30.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.9% cyan, 50.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 69.8% black. It has a hue angle of 213.4 degrees, a saturation of 83.3% and a lightness of 16.5%. #07264d color hex could be obtained by blending #0e4c9a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

● #07264d color description : Very dark blue.
#07264d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#07264d has RGB values of R:7, G:38, B:77 and CMYK values of C:0.91, M:0.51, Y:0, K:0.7. Its decimal value is 468557.

Shades and Tints of #07264d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000305 is the darkest color, while #f2f7f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#07264d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#272a2d is the less saturated color, while #012553 is the most saturated one.
